Fortnite has still yet to release the patch notes for the upcoming holiday event, but dataminers HYPEX and xKleinMikex have still unveiled several new images for the event. Last year Fortnite had a full 14 Day event set with a long list of challenges, map changes, and surprises that was renewed in the new year. However, the details of this year’s even have been kept under lock and key, until now.
Dataminers HYPEX and xKleinMikex, known for leaking major reveals in Fortnite, have been searching for weeks for the latest news and have recently uncovered a new snow map. The previous map had just one section dedicated to the frozen biome, this new map appears to be totally covered. Fans of Fortnite haven’t seen the map completely covered in snow since the beginning of Chapter 2, but the deep freeze is well on its way.
Things will start heating up once the Winter Royale is underway and $15 million is up for grabs. HYPEX has also unveiled some of the WinterFest challenges, including hiding inside a “sneaky snowman” and dancing at “Holiday trees” around the map. It also appears that presents are coming back to the game as they did in previous seasons where presents were like mini loot boxes that players could open or share with their teammates.
A few building designs have also been leaked, revealing that there will be an Ice Hotel which very well may be the “WinterFest Cabin” seen on the challenges list. Other buildings that have been revealed are a toy factory, an old Crackshot house, and a ski building. Among the holiday-themed skins and emotes (many are reindeer themed), HYPEX is also uncovering several details about the Star Wars event just in time for Star Wars: The Rise of Skywalker.
In just a few days on December 14th, 2019, Fortnite will be teaming up with Disney to unveil a brand new scene from the upcoming Star Wars: The Rise of Skywalker. Players will need to log in around 10:30 am PT, and head over to Risky Reels for the exclusive Epic Star Wars content. At the time of this article, it is still unclear when the Fortnite Winter patch will go into effect, but players can still count on enjoying the upcoming Star Wars event this Saturday.
